[PATCH v7 06/19] clk: mediatek: Add MT8188 camsys clock support

AngeloGioacchino Del Regno angelogioacchino.delregno at collabora.com
Fri Mar 31 02:53:38 PDT 2023


Il 31/03/23 10:21, Garmin.Chang ha scritto:
> Add MT8188 camsys clock controllers which provide clock gate
> control for camera IP blocks.
> 
> Signed-off-by: Garmin.Chang <Garmin.Chang at mediatek.com>
> Reviewed-by: Chen-Yu Tsai <wenst at chromium.org>
> ---
>   drivers/clk/mediatek/Kconfig          |   7 ++
>   drivers/clk/mediatek/Makefile         |   1 +
>   drivers/clk/mediatek/clk-mt8188-cam.c | 120 ++++++++++++++++++++++++++
>   3 files changed, 128 insertions(+)
>   create mode 100644 drivers/clk/mediatek/clk-mt8188-cam.c
> 
> diff --git a/drivers/clk/mediatek/Kconfig b/drivers/clk/mediatek/Kconfig
> index 681d392620c5..9170f76a8ee7 100644
> --- a/drivers/clk/mediatek/Kconfig
> +++ b/drivers/clk/mediatek/Kconfig
> @@ -692,6 +692,13 @@ config COMMON_CLK_MT8188
>   	help
>             This driver supports MediaTek MT8188 clocks.
>   
> +config COMMON_CLK_MT8188_CAMSYS
> +	tristate "Clock driver for MediaTek MT8188 camsys"
> +	depends on COMMON_CLK_MT8188_VPPSYS
> +	default COMMON_CLK_MT8188_VPPSYS
> +	help
> +	  This driver supports MediaTek MT8188 camsys and camsys_raw clocks.
> +
>   config COMMON_CLK_MT8192
>   	tristate "Clock driver for MediaTek MT8192"
>   	depends on ARM64 || COMPILE_TEST
> diff --git a/drivers/clk/mediatek/Makefile b/drivers/clk/mediatek/Makefile
> index 1a642510ce38..c235e9a0d305 100644
> --- a/drivers/clk/mediatek/Makefile
> +++ b/drivers/clk/mediatek/Makefile
> @@ -102,6 +102,7 @@ obj-$(CONFIG_COMMON_CLK_MT8186_VENCSYS) += clk-mt8186-venc.o
>   obj-$(CONFIG_COMMON_CLK_MT8186_WPESYS) += clk-mt8186-wpe.o
>   obj-$(CONFIG_COMMON_CLK_MT8188) += clk-mt8188-apmixedsys.o clk-mt8188-topckgen.o \
>   				   clk-mt8188-peri_ao.o clk-mt8188-infra_ao.o
> +j-$(CONFIG_COMMON_CLK_MT8188_CAMSYS) += clk-mt8188-cam.o

Please fix that typo here.

After which,
Reviewed-by: AngeloGioacchino Del Regno <angelogioacchino.delregno at collabora.com>





More information about the linux-arm-kernel mailing list